Nazarali Pirnazarov




DUSHANBE


, May 8, Asia-Plus – On Saturday May 6, President Rahmonov met with a group of Tajik veterans of the Great Patriotic War of 1941-1945 and labor from various regions of the country.   

According to information from presidential press service, more than 20 veterans attended that meeting.   Addressing the veterans Rahmonov congratulated them on a Victory Day.  He noted that that war had been a hard ordeal for peoples of 40 countries of the world and it had killed 50 million people. 

Rahmonov noted that 54 representatives from


Tajikistan


had been given a title of the Hero of the

Soviet Union

and 15 others had become full holders of the Glory Order. 

In total, 250,000 people from


Tajikistan


participated in the Great Patriotic War of 1941-1945; of them, more than 90,000 servicemen died in that war.  

Telling the meeting Rahmonov noted that modern challenges and threats had become terrorism, extremism, drug trafficking and transnational crime and international community should combine efforts to address these challenges and threats.  “


Tajikistan


is against any manifestations of racism and ideas of chauvinism,” President Rahmonov stressed.

Head of state noted that the country’s leadership was doing all in its power for improving living standards of the war veterans living in the republic.  According to him, not less than 6,000 veterans of the Great Patriotic War of 11941-1945 are currently living in


Tajikistan


.  Beginning on May 1, presidential pension of 100 Somonis (more than US$30.00) a month is added to the pension of the veterans and invalids of the Great Patriotic War of 1941-1945.  

At the conclusion of the meeting President Rahmonov handed to the veterans extraordinary grant of 300 Somonis each.  

On occasion of the 61

st

anniversary of the Victory in the Great Patriotic War of 1941-1945 a demonstration-requiem will be held in the


Victory


Park


in


Dushanbe


on May 9.  A military parade also will be held on this occasion in the


Victory


Park


tomorrow.  President Rahmonov, heads of both Chambers of Tajik Parliament, and Defense Minister will attend the parade involving some 1,000 servicemen of


Tajikistan


’s Armed Forces.
